Emmanuel is a diverse group of
people all seeking to love God and to
follow Jesus
Christ in this great adventure of life he has called us to.
At Emmanuel we are on a journey. And the aim of that journey
is that each of us would become more like Jesus Christ.
Being a Christian isn’t about “getting to
heaven”,
though our future hope of a renewed heaven and earth is very important.
Being a Christian is about being transformed and becoming the person
God made you to be. It’s about reflecting
Jesus’
character as God’s Spirit gets to work in your
life. It's
about being found, when you were lost. It's about responding
to
the amazing love of the mysterious, all-powerful creator we dare to
call "Father".
It's about using and discovering the gifts he has given you.
And it’s about taking part in God’s plan to restore
every
area of life in whatever we do. Every square inch of creation
belongs to Jesus Christ. Come and join us in the adventure.
